Francis Rowinski
From Infogalactic: the planetary knowledge core
Francis Carl Rowinski (September 10, 1918 – August 4, 1990) was born in Dickson City, Pennsylvania. He was ordained to the priesthood on May 17, 1939 and consecrated bishop on May 9, 1959, and served as diocesan Bishop of the Western Diocese of the Polish National Catholic Church from 1959 to 1978, when he was appointed Prime Bishop of the PNCC. He was appointed Bishop Ordinary of the Buffalo-Pittsburgh Diocese of the PNCC on October 3, 1978, and retired in June, 1990.
